
This verse seems like a magic incantation that at any moment a genie will pop up to grant you a wish. How many times have you asked God for something and not received it? How often have you looked for something and not found it? What about knocking on a door that remains closed?
We look deeper into this and see what God is telling us to do: PRAY!
Prayer is our way into the Father’s Throne room! The second part of the scripture talks about seeking and finding – if you lost a precious ring you would search high and low to find it. You wouldn’t just tell your friend “Hey, I lost my ring, isn’t that terrible? “. On the contrary, you would tear apart your home to find it. So keep praying – keep asking! Don’t give up.

As we continue reading we see that God is comparing Himself to us as parents. We would do everything in our power to give them all they ask for. As a parent, I can relate to this. I want to make things easier for my children and give them those things I didn’t have. I do expect a sort of humble attitude or willingness to help around the house. If they are behaving mischievously and are demanding, I would be less inclined to give it to them. So let’s be mindful of how we come to God when we pray. Let’s be expectant but not demanding: let’s ask our Father for what we need without airs or pretense. Let’s be authentic! He wants to bless us beyond our imagination!
